Regulatory Harmonization and Its Impact on Player Trust

One of the most significant developments in recent years has been the push towards international harmonization of online gambling laws. Countries like the UK, Malta, and Gibraltar have established multi-tiered licensing frameworks that set stringent standards for operators. These regulations emphasize algorithms’ transparency, secure payment processing, and reliable customer support, which collectively bolster player confidence.

For instance, the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C) rigorously audits casino operators to ensure fair play and responsible gambling. As a result, players can verify the legitimacy of a platform by checking for active licenses, which are often prominently displayed on the site.

Such measures also facilitate cross-border cooperation, allowing regulators to share information about fraudulent activities and safeguard players worldwide.

The Role of Responsible Gambling Technologies

Innovation in responsible gambling tools has emerged as a cornerstone of contemporary regulation. Advanced algorithms now enable real-time monitoring of player behavior, flagging signs of problem gambling and prompting intervention measures. Platforms integrate features like self-exclusion programs, deposit limits, and reality checks, empowering players to maintain control over their gambling habits.

Notably, some operators have partnered with independent bodies to develop AI-driven detection systems that analyze betting patterns to identify risky behavior proactively. These innovations demonstrate an industry committed to prioritizing player well-being while maintaining compliance with emerging regulatory frameworks.

The Future Outlook: Technology and Regulation Convergence

Emerging Trend Description Industry Impact
Blockchain Transparency Leveraging blockchain for provably fair gaming and transparent result verification. Increases data integrity and builds player trust.
Artificial Intelligence & Machine Learning Enhanced monitoring of player activity, fraud detection, and customization of responsible gambling tools. Boosts safety standards and compliance efficiency.
Regulatory Sandboxes Testing new gambling technologies within controlled environments before wider deployment. Accelerates innovation while ensuring regulatory oversight.
